Chest level affects the minimum level of any randomly generated loot that appears in that chest, and is usually equal to the quest's Normal CR, -1 on Casual, +1 on Hard, +2 on Elite, +any current global or personal loot boosts. Starting from easiest, these are Solo, Casual, Normal, Hard, Elite, and Reaper. There are five ranks to a level (each rank is 1/5 of the total amount of experience needed to level up).
